Takeya, a brand we have shot for in the past, came to us in April of this year with a need to not only shoot, but update their brand visuals almost from the ground up. Having for years looked for ways to keep shoots incredibly affordable, they were ready to invest more into the process to raise the bar and more effectively speak with their athletic user demographic with strong Southern California vibes. We began a rigorous process of reviewing where they had been and set goals for where they wanted to go, while leaving room for exploration. We discussed their desired voice and reach and then planned a project right in the thick of Covid. There are many challenges a commercial production faces in the best of times and we viewed Covid as just another element to plan for and around. When possible we cast real families or friend groups who had already been sheltering together and felt comfortable being in close proximity without masks, while we, the client and crew, all practiced full Covid safety protocols. In the end, it wasn’t that huge of a hurdle and we produced an amazing shoot with on target results and are already in production for the next project this fall.
